Melbourne would be one of the ports where I would consider the debarkation tour, depending on the cost.  
It is very day dependent and if it is a morning peak hour where there is an accident on one of the freeways it could take a long time.  Alternatively on a weekend it could take half an hour to the airport in very little traffic.
